Using the Outbox

You must assign a Directory Number (DN) key the Outbox before you can
use this feature. After you assign a DN key, the IP Phone logs all outgoing
calls from that DN. The system logs the outgoing key number, time, and
date. If the duration of the call is more than two seconds, the system
captures the display as it appeared when the call was made.
The Outbox can store a maximum of 10 calls. When the maximum is
reached, the oldest call is dropped. Calls appear in the list in order in which
they were made, with the most recent call at the top of the list.
The Outbox call display consists of a time or date stamp and a name or
number. A time stamp appears beside calls you made on the same day on
which you view the Outbox. A date stamp appears beside calls that were
made prior to the day of viewing. If no name or number was extracted from
the display of the outgoing call, the numbered dialed appears. Use the up
and down navigation keys to scroll through the list. The list does not wrap
around.
